About Old Court Barn Residential Care Home
Old Court Barn Residential Care Home is a residential care home in Lugwardine, in the Herefordshire, County of council area, registered with the Care Quality Commission for up to 7 residents. It provides care for people with a learning disability or autism. It is run by Mr Steven Richard Dodds. The home has been registered since January 2011.
At its latest inspection, published March 2019, the CQC rated Old Court Barn Residential Care Home Good, which means the CQC found the service performing well and meeting its expectations. Ratings can change after a new inspection, so check the CQC report before you visit.
Old Court Barn Residential Care Home has not published its fees and we are still collecting figures for Herefordshire, County of. Across England residential care usually costs £900 to £1,400 a week and nursing care £1,200 to £1,900. Ask the home for a written quote that lists what is included.

Does Old Court Barn Residential Care Home provide nursing care?
No. Old Court Barn Residential Care Home is registered as a care home without nursing. Staff provide personal care; visiting district nurses cover nursing needs.
